Life at Home 'Relaxing' The night is typical of most evenings spent at home during the school year. You managed to do your home- work after school, and you've finally finished the dinner dishes. You're all set for a nice, relaxing evening in front of the T. V. But just as you turn on part two of a super movie, big brother walks in and chages the channel to the baseball game. A big argu- ment erupts over what show is going to be seen on the only television in the house. Finally, after at least 15 minutes and about an inning of the baseball game, your father decides he's had enough of this hollering and steps in. There's no doubt as to what the decision is going to be. So much for the movie. This has happened several times before, but this time you've reached your limit. So you complain and carry on and pout and make sure everybody knows your upset. Your dad, trying both to make you happy and also to get you to leave him alone, attempts to help you find something to do. Go do your homework, he suggests. I already have, you snap back in a tone that obviously aggravates him. Well, do some more, he yells. You've been slacking off on your homework lately. If you don't do your work and get good grades, you're never going to get into col- lege. And since he's your father and since this isn't exactly the first time you've heard this lecture, you agree to return to the books. Before he can say anything more, you make your way up to your room and put your favorite album on the stereo.
